CLARKS Village is getting into the Coronation spirit with a weekend of celebrations.

The shopping outlet is hosting a range of coronation features including a musical playlist of Britain’s most iconic artists, floral decorative selfie spots, food stalls, garden games, competitions and exclusive coronation memorabilia – all at discounted outlet prices.

Guests will be invited to sit back and relax on summer deckchairs in Clarks Village’s landscaped gardens and soak up live music from busker Conor Smith or try their hand at bean bag toss, giant Connect4, table football and table tennis.

Surrounding the Central Square Gardens and in the Pear Court area will be market food stalls Chickies Gourmet Scotch Eggs, My Greek Fat Wraps, Village Bite Box and Bubble T along with the newly opened Load ‘o’ Waffle. And Beckford’s Rum will showcase its award-winning produce, and Sean the Chef will offer sweet treats and bakes.

A pergola of silk flowers has been installed, while the floral swing will return. The Insta-worthy displays have been created by floral designer Shilpa Reddy and will be in-situ until June 4.

Younger guests will be take part in a ‘colour the crown’ competition in the guest services hub with a chance to win a limited-edition Emma Bridgewater King Charles III decorated mug.

Guests also have a chance to win an Emma Bridgewater Coronation Teapot on Clarks Village’s social media channels. The outlet’s musical playlist will be switched for a ‘Best of British’ theme and The Grange entrance will be lit up in traditional red, white and blue to welcome guests.

There will be coronation eats, treats, decorations and memorabilia across the outlet’s 90 brands, offering up to 60 per cent off RRP.

Chris Davis, centre director of Clarks Village, said: “We’re going all out to give our guests the royal treatment at Clarks Village as we celebrate King Charles III’s coronation.

"From decorations and food stalls to family activities and entertainment as well as commemorative memorabilia and outlet-exclusive discounts, it’s going to be a very special weekend.”
